			<p>	We photographed this year&#8217;s Top Singles, the area&#8217;s 20 most eligible bachelors and bachelorettes, in settings that best fit their respective personalities. Whether we showed them being adventurous at the National Aquarium, inquisitive at the Peabody Library, creative at the BMA, or cultured at Verde Pizza, these spots made the ideal backdrop. (Not to mention we got to play with sharks, climb on sculptures, snack on pizza, and explore old books.) Just goes to show: This city is full of fun—you just have to know where to look!</p>

			<div class="vc_single_image-wrapper   vc_box_border_grey"><img fetchpriority="high" decoding="async" width="2040" height="2560" src="https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les2-scaled.jpg" class="vc_single_image-img attachment-full" alt="a FEB 14 SINGLES2" title="a FEB 14 SINGLES2" srcset="https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les2-scaled.jpg 2040w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les2-637x800.jpg 637w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les2-768x964.jpg 768w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les2-1224x1536.jpg 1224w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les2-1632x2048.jpg 1632w" sizes="(max-width: 2040px) 100vw, 2040px" /></div><figcaption class="vc_figure-caption">On location: The National Aquarium. The Aquarium’s new Blacktip Reef exhibit replicates an Indo-Pacific reef with sharks, stingrays, and a 500-pound sea turtle named Calypso. 501 E. Pratt Street, 410-576-3800, aqua.org - Photography by David Colwell</figcaption>

			<div class="vc_single_image-wrapper   vc_box_border_grey"><img decoding="async" width="2032" height="2560" src="https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les3-scaled.jpg" class="vc_single_image-img attachment-full" alt="a FEB 14 SINGLES3" title="a FEB 14 SINGLES3" srcset="https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les3-scaled.jpg 2032w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les3-635x800.jpg 635w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les3-768x967.jpg 768w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les3-1219x1536.jpg 1219w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/06/a-feb-14-singles3-1626x2048.jpg 1626w" sizes="(max-width: 2032px) 100vw, 2032px" /></div><figcaption class="vc_figure-caption">On location: The Baltimore Museum of Art. This backdrop was in the BMA’s contemporary wing, which features more than 100 objects from the likes of Jasper Johns and Andy Warhol. 10 Art Museum Drive, 443-573-1700, artbma.org. - Photography by David Colwell</figcaption>

			<div class="vc_single_image-wrapper   vc_box_border_grey"><img decoding="async" width="2262" height="2560" src="https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/a-feb-14-singles4-scaled.jpg" class="vc_single_image-img attachment-full" alt="a FEB 14 SINGLES4" title="a FEB 14 SINGLES4" srcset="https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/a-feb-14-singles4-scaled.jpg 2262w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/a-feb-14-singles4-707x800.jpg 707w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/a-feb-14-singles4-768x869.jpg 768w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/a-feb-14-singles4-1357x1536.jpg 1357w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/a-feb-14-singles4-1809x2048.jpg 1809w, https://www.baltimoremagazine.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/a-feb-14-singles4-480x543.jpg 480w" sizes="(max-width: 2262px) 100vw, 2262px" /></div><figcaption class="vc_figure-caption">On location: George Peabody Library This 19th-century research library of The Johns Hopkins University contains 300,000 volumes and is available to host private events. 17 E. Mt. Vernon Place, 410-234-4943, peabodyevents.library.jhu.edu. - Photography by David Colwell</figcaption>

			<p>	There&#8217;s only so much a first date, online dating profile, or Facebook page can tell you about potential suitors. Maybe what they do, where they went to school, some of their favorite bands, perhaps an inspirational quote or two. But we wanted to delve a little deeper—to see what makes the 20 top singles in Baltimore tick. We reveal their hidden talents, quirky collections, dream jobs, and traits their friends might not even know exist.</p>
